Fluorescence In Situ Hybridization (FISH) in Diagnostic and Investigative Neuropathology

Over the last decade, fluorescence in situ hybridization (FISH) has emerged as a powerful clinical and research tool for the assessment of target DNA dosages within interphase nuclei.
